Bedham Hall Bed and Breakfast

Bedham Hall Bed and Breakfast Address: 4835 River Road, Niagara Falls City, Canada

Minimum price found for Bedham Hall Bed and Breakfast was: Null CAD

Click here to get more information, photos & guest ratings for Bedham Hall Bed and Breakfast